Output dc14f0ca3a1ceb5f8f0af55dbe62c263a200ff682fd2ad2e7c4bfbbce1745198:1

value
14993922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22866f81857f6b51b8db29397f3b142dd0020600 OP_EQUAL
address
34qZwp7hRiWmSEuArPcER13aNh2rRaXYaB
transaction
dc14f0ca3a1ceb5f8f0af55dbe62c263a200ff682fd2ad2e7c4bfbbce1745198
confirmations
393854
spent
true